Crosscall and Data Select Announce Partnership for Telecoms Market

Crosscall, a French manufacturer specialising in sustainable telephony, has recently announced a strategic partnership with Data Select, a trading division of Westcoast Limited. The partnership aims to strengthen Crosscall’s mobile technology offering in the UK.

Crosscall has been designing ultra-resistant smartphones for the past 15 years, phones designed to withstand rugged conditions and damage, and Crosscall smartphones come with a 5-year warranty, including battery, enabling companies to reduce the frequency of replacement of their devices and cut costs. Crosscall’s latest model, the STELLAR-X5, incorporates an AI noise reduction solution, offering optimal communication even in noisy environments. With over 20 years’ experience, Data Select supports the UK channel with a comprehensive portfolio of mobile products, solutions and services, and so the partnership is a good match of experience and undertstanding of the mobile sector.

In France, Crosscall terminals are already used by some of the country’s most important companies and institutions, including the Ministry of the Interior, SNCF (the French state-owned railway company) and Leroy Merlin, the specialist home retailer.

For Crosscall, thie partnership marks an important step in the company’s development. The UK is a key market in its internationalisation strategy, and the French manufacturer will be relying on the full range of services offered by Data Select to accelerate its development there.
